"There's evidence for God everywhere, but only for the person who's willing to look. God wants to be found, but above all, he wants to know who will look, who will seek him. In effect, this reverses the question.
"It's not why doesn't God show himself, but am I really willing to look? The French writer Blaise Pascal put it this way there is enough light for those who only want to see, and enough shadow for those who don't.
"Of course, for Christians, the greatest light that shows God's love is Jesus born, lived, died, and rose again in history. And who still wants to be found by anyone who will look?"
